The paper is concerned with the non-self-similar problem of a central explosion accompanied by the detonation of a homogeneous gravitating gas sphere. The problem is solved by using the asymptotic method of a thin shock layer proposed by Chernyi (1957) and involving a small parameter. The use of the small parameter makes it possible to describe the expansion of the main mass of the gas into vacuum.
